Active ingredient

Phoxim

Description

Phoxim is a potent active ingredient belonging to the organophosphate class of chemicals. In agricultural production, it serves as a broad-spectrum insecticide characterized by strong contact and stomach action. It is widely recognized for its ability to manage populations of various pests that threaten crop productivity by disrupting their physiological processes.

The mode of action of Phoxim involves the inhibition of the enzyme acetylcholinesterase within the insect's nervous system. By blocking this essential enzyme, the substance causes an accumulation of the neurotransmitter acetylcholine, leading to continuous neural excitement, paralysis, and the eventual death of the target pest. This mechanism ensures a rapid knockdown effect after ingestion or direct contact.

Phoxim is primarily utilized on a variety of crops, including cereals, potatoes, sugar beets, and various vegetables grown in open fields. It is particularly effective against soil-dwelling pests, such as wireworms and white grubs, as well as several leaf-eating caterpillars. Its use in soil treatment makes it a versatile tool for integrated pest management programs.

A notable feature of Phoxim is its relatively short residual activity when exposed to direct sunlight, as it is susceptible to photodecomposition. To maximize effectiveness, field applications should be performed during the evening or combined with soil incorporation. The substance does not exhibit systemic properties, meaning it remains on the surface or within the soil matrix where it was applied.

Safety precautions are paramount when handling Phoxim due to its toxicity to humans and non-target organisms. Operators must wear appropriate personal protective equipment, including respirators and chemical-resistant clothing. Strict adherence to pre-harvest intervals (PHI) is necessary to ensure that residues on the final product are within the safety limits established by agricultural authorities.

Regulatory

Status in the European Union

Not approved in the EU

CAS number
14816-18-3
Category (EU)
IN - Insecticide
Hazard classification (CLP)
Acute Tox. 4 - H302Aquatic Acute 1 - H400Aquatic Chronic 1 - H410Repr. 2 - H361fSkin Sens. 1 - H317
